财务软件突然连不上数据库了,修复要花多少钱?

2026-05-27 12:49:03   来源:技王数据恢复

财务软件突然连不上数据库了,修复要花多少钱?

财务软件登录时提示“连接数据库失败”“无法连接到服务器”或直接闪退,这是企业财务人员最怕遇到的故障之一。问题既可能是软件层面的配置错误,也可能是数据库文件损坏,甚至是存储设备的硬件故障。不同原因对应的修复难度和费用差异很大,本文从真实案例出发帮你理清思路。 技王数据恢复

常见故障原因分析

财务软件连不上数据库,通常由以下几类原因引起: 技王数据恢复

  • 数据库服务未启动或崩溃——SQL Server或MySQL服务意外停止,重启服务后多数可恢复。
  • 网络连接问题——服务器IP变更、防火墙阻挡或端口被占用。
  • 数据库文件(.mdf/.ldf)逻辑损坏——异常断电、非法关机导致文件头损坏或页错误。
  • 存储介质物理故障——硬盘出现坏道、磁头卡死、RAID阵列失效等。
  • 系统更新或杀毒软件误删——部分更新补丁可能影响数据库引擎,杀毒软件可能隔离数据库文件。

不同原因修复费用从几百元到数千元不等,硬件物理故障通常费用更高。

技王数据恢复

两个真实恢复案例

案例一:Windows Server RAID5 数据库文件逻辑损坏

设备与环境:某企业一台Windows Server 2016服务器,4块2TB西数硬盘组成RAID5阵列,存储用友财务软件的SQL Server数据库。

技王数据恢复

故障现象:上班时财务软件客户端全部提示“连接数据库失败”,服务器上SQL Server服务无法启动,尝试重启服务器后故障依旧。查看系统日志发现数据库文件(.mdf)所在分区有I/O错误。 www.sosit.com.cn

处理过程:工程师先检测RAID5阵列状态,确认4块硬盘均无物理坏道,阵列处于“正常”状态。使用PC-3000 for RAID工具对阵列进行完整镜像,再通过SQL Server数据库修复工具扫描镜像文件,发现数据库文件头严重损坏,多个关键页结构错乱。经过逐页校验和重建,修复了文件头及系统表损坏部分。

www.sosit.com.cn

恢复结果:关键数据完整导出,财务账套成功附加回SQL Server,所有凭证、科目余额和报表均可正常打开,未发现明显损坏。整个修复耗时约2个工作日,费用在2000–3500元区间(按数据量和损坏程度计费)。

技王数据恢复

案例二:移动硬盘物理故障导致备份无法读取

设备与场景:某公司财务人员使用一块2TB希捷移动硬盘(型号ST2000LM015)存放每月财务数据库的完整备份文件。该硬盘已使用约3年,日常插拔频繁。

技王数据恢复

故障现象:财务软件连接不上数据库后,财务经理打算从移动硬盘恢复备份。插入硬盘后系统能识别盘符但读取卡顿,随后硬盘发出“咔咔”异响,之后盘符消失,系统提示“设备无法识别”。

处理过程:判断为磁头组件老化导致磁头卡滞,不能再通电尝试。在无尘室进行开盘操作,更换同型号匹配磁头,然后使用MRT工具对硬盘进行高精度镜像。镜像过程中遇到多处坏道,通过调整参数跳过损伤区域,最终完成全盘镜像。从镜像文件中提取出近3个月的财务备份文件(.bak)。

恢复结果:大部分数据恢复,其中最近两个月的备份文件完整可用,三个月前的备份部分数据页损坏,但通过SQL Server的page restore机制恢复了主要财务表。开盘费用加数据提取共花费3800元左右,耗时3个工作日。

自助排查操作步骤

在联系专业人员之前,可以按以下步骤尝试排查,但务必注意风险:

财务软件突然连不上数据库了,修复要花多少钱?

  • 步骤1:检查数据库服务是否运行。打开“服务”管理器(services.msc),找到SQL Server或对应数据库服务,查看状态是否为“正在运行”。若已停止,尝试手动启动。预期结果:服务正常启动后财务软件可连上。注意:若启动时报错“文件无法访问”或“文件损坏”,立即停止操作,不要反复重启。
  • 步骤2:测试网络连通性。在客户端电脑ping服务器IP,使用telnet测试数据库端口(默认1433)。预期结果:能ping通且端口开放说明网络正常。注意:若ping不通,检查IP地址和防火墙规则,不要随意改动数据库配置。
  • 步骤3:查看Windows系统日志与SQL Server错误日志。打开“事件查看器”,查看“应用程序”和“系统”日志中与数据库相关的错误。预期结果:日志可能直接指出文件损坏或I/O错误。注意:若出现“错误823”“错误824”或“文件头损坏”等关键词,说明数据库文件已逻辑损坏,不要再尝试附加或重启。
  • 步骤4:使用DBCC检查数据库完整性(仅限服务可启动时)。在SQL Server Management Studio中执行“DBCC CHECKDB('数据库名')”。预期结果:无错误则数据库完整,有错误会提示损坏级别。注意:如果服务已无法启动,不要强行启动,直接联系专业恢复机构。
  • 步骤5:检查存储设备健康状态。用CrystalDiskInfo或HD Tune查看硬盘SMART信息,检查是否有“重新分配扇区数”“当前待映射扇区数”异常。预期结果:数值正常则硬盘物理状态良好。注意:如果听到异响或系统卡死,立即断电,不要再做任何软件扫描。

风险提醒

物理故障(硬盘异响、掉盘、不识别):

  • 不要反复通电尝试,二次损伤会使磁头划伤盘片,大幅降低恢复成功率。
  • 不要自行拆盘,开盘需要在无尘室中进行,普通环境会引入灰尘颗粒。
  • 不要使用任何软件强行扫描或格式化,这只会加重坏道扩散。
  • 出现坏道、异响或物理损伤的原盘,不建议继续保存重要数据,应尽快镜像到新硬盘。

逻辑故障(文件损坏、误删、提示格式化):

  • 不要对原盘进行格式化或初始化操作,格式化会覆盖原有数据区域。
  • 不要将恢复出来的数据直接写到原盘,应拷贝到其他独立存储设备上。
  • 如果是数据库文件损坏,不要随意用第三方工具“修复”原文件,以免造成二次破坏。

FAQ常见问题

Q1:财务软件连接不上数据库,重装软件有用吗?

重装软件通常只覆盖客户端程序,对数据库文件本身没有影响。如果是数据库服务配置问题或文件损坏,重装客户端解决不了根本问题。建议先确认数据库服务能否正常启动,再判断是否需要文件级修复。

Q2:数据库文件损坏了,数据还能找回来吗?

绝大多数逻辑损坏(如文件头损坏、页损坏)都可以通过专业手段恢复,关键数据完整导出的概率很高。但如果是物理介质严重损伤(如盘片划伤),恢复比例会受影响。建议第一时间停止操作,联系有数据库恢复经验的机构,技王数据恢复工程师曾处理过大量类似案例,可根据损坏程度给出具体评估。

Q3:恢复财务数据库大概需要多长时间?

逻辑损坏通常在1–3个工作日可完成,物理故障则需要根据损伤程度和镜像速度,一般3–7个工作日。紧急情况可加急处理,但费用会相应提高。

Q4:修复费用大概是多少?有没有统一标准?

费用没有统一标准,主要取决于故障类型、数据量大小、损坏程度和所需工时。逻辑故障一般在800–3000元之间,物理故障(如开盘)在3000–6000元甚至更高。正规机构会在检测后给出报价单,不会随意加价。

总结

财务软件连接不上数据库,先不要慌。先判断是逻辑故障还是硬件故障:如果服务器能正常启动、硬盘无异常声音,大概率是逻辑损坏;如果硬盘有异响、卡顿或掉盘,则很可能是物理故障。逻辑故障≠硬件故障,逻辑损坏的数据恢复成功率很高,但前提是停止错误操作。不要反复重启、不要格式化、不要强行附加数据库。数据重要时,第一时间断电并联系专业数据恢复机构,才能最大限度保障财务数据的安全。

上一篇:没有进行正确初始化电子钥匙盘什么意思 数据能修复到什么程度 下一篇:群晖存储池老是损坏是什么原因?远程恢复靠谱可靠吗?
搜索